    Abstract:

    The sortie generation rate of military aircraft is a significant parameter to evaluate the dispatched ability. This article, taking the coefficient of utilization and the cost of support equipment as constraint conditions, and taking the aircraft sortie generation rate as objective function, establishes a MonteCarlo queuing simulation model. The article utilizes the numerical values of objective function through MonteCarlo simulation, and then optimizes the configuration projections of support equipment in applying the genetic algorithm to satisfy the constraint conditions maximizing the sortie generation rate. The article analyzes the sensitivity of sortie generation rate of aircraft, and obtains a curve line about allocation proportion of support equipment of influencing on the sortie generation rate.
